| Editorial Reviews:
Amazon.com Product Description Designed to quickly and easily preserve precious memories, HP's ScanJet G4050 Photo Scanner lets you scan slides, negatives, and photos with superior color accuracy. Capture realistic color with high-definition photo and film scanning through HP's exclusive 96-bit scanning. Enjoy high-definition scans with 4,800 x 9,600 dpi resolution and preserve crisp text in scanned documents. The device comes with built-in dust and scratch removal tools, and you can edit text from scanned documents and magazines. Scan up to 16 35mm slides or 30 negative frames at once and bring old or damaged photos back to life by restoring faded colors. Superior color accuracy, high-definition scans with 4800 x 9600 dpi, and speedy previews (as fast as 8.5 seconds) are easily achieved with the G4050. Compatible with Windows 2000 and later and Mac OS X 10.3.8 and later operating systems, the scanner is backed by a 1-year manufacturer's limited warranty. Weighing in at just over 11.5 pounds, the scanner measures 20 x 11.93 x 4.25 inches. What's in the Box HP Scanjet G4050 photo scanner, template kit, USB cable, power supply adapter/power cords, software and User's Guide CDs, Setup and Support Guide, and I.R.I.S. registration flyer

Great HW, weak SW January 7, 2009 Willysp Have had this for a week and overall pleased. Comments (based on only 35mm slides): - Very good HW; solidly built, good scan quality - HW dust removal takes a long time, and not very effective. It's quicker (with good results) for me to use an anti-static brush on the slides, and then use the Healing Tool in PS CS4. - 6 color and higher bit depth make the scan time significantly longer, and I can't see a difference in high dpi scans. - The HP-provided software is the weak link here. Settings and Help are both spread out in 2 or 3 different areas, and hard to understand (and I work with computers for a living). - The deal-breaker for me regarding the HP software is that the auto- select/crop for slides is always off. It consistently cuts off left and bottom (and the amount varies), and there is no way to fix it except laboriously selecting each single slide, zooming in, manually changing the selection area, zooming out - and doing this 16 times for a batch of slides. - I switched to Vuescan SW and am quite pleased with it. Significantly more features and easier to use. Overall, very pleased with quality and price of the scanner, but IMO it needs 3rd party SW to make it easy to use.

Problen]ms if you have both HP-G4050- and Photosmart D7360 December 27, 2008 Mansoor A. Saifi (USA) I bought this form Amazon, it was defective, and Amzon was fast in shipping a repalcement. My problems started when I installed the HP supplied software version 8.2 for Windows Media XP on the HP computer. The installed scanner would not work. Had four days of back and forth e-mails with HP help center.Did every thing they suggested, none worked. At last HP help center suggested going to HP website and downloading a new version of software (9). Was confused because similar version 9 for Microsoft Vista. I was told it is new software for XP Media Edition and once this software was installed it works. Still lot of bugs, for example can not remove the old version (8.2) from the computer, and often the system stops responding. HP needs to improve their software and software patches. I normally do not post any comments, but if you have HP Photsmart Printer, beware of the software incompatiblity between HP G4050 and Photsamart D7360.
